Defibrillators are devices that apply an electric charge or current to the heart to restore a normal heartbeat. If the heart rhythm stops due to cardiac arrest, also known as sudden cardiac arrest (SCA), a defibrillator may help it start beating again.
Automated external defibrillators (AEDs) are portable, life-saving devices designed to treat people experiencing sudden cardiac arrest, a medical condition in which the heart stops beating suddenly and unexpectedly.

Public access defibrillation programs that place automated external defibrillators (AEDs) in areas where cardiac arrests may occur can reduce the response time up to three to five minutes. The following references provide information for establishing an effective AED program in the workplace.
An automated external defibrillator (AED) is a portable device that can be used to treat a person whose heart has suddenly stopped working. This condition is called sudden cardiac arrest. AEDs are available in many public places, such as government buildings, schools, airports and other community spaces.
An Automated External Defibrillator (AED) must only be used for persons who are unresponsive and not breathing normally. With cardiac arrest, time to defibrillation is a key factor that influences a person's chance of survival.
AED analyses heart rhythm; Listen to AED instructions; If the AED prompts to give shock, stay clear of the patient. After the AED delivers the shock, continue CPR with compressions until the person responds, or normal breathing returns, or the paramedics take over.

The Automated External Defibrillator Program Application is a form that organizations or entities must complete to comply with regulations regarding the acquisition and use of Automated External Defibrillators (AEDs) in specific locations.
Entities that intend to acquire, operate, or maintain AEDs, including schools, businesses, public facilities, and healthcare providers, are typically required to file this application.
To fill out the application, applicants need to provide detailed information about the organization, location of the AED, training protocols for users, maintenance plans, and compliance with local laws and regulations.
The purpose of the application is to ensure that AEDs are deployed in a safe and responsible manner, that proper training is provided, and that there is accountability for their maintenance and usage to effectively respond to cardiac emergencies.
The application must report information such as the organization's name and address, AED location, number of AEDs, training qualifications of staff, response plans, and maintenance schedules.
